A 32-year-old male asked:

Is a dermatologist the best type of doctor to see for skin/swelling and pain around the urethra on my penis? ive seen a urologist who didnt really offer much advice and two dermatologists but none have been able to diagnose my problem yet?

2 doctor answers2 doctors weighed in
Dr. Mark Owolabi
Family Medicine 8 years experience
It would be helpful to know what those doctors ruled out when it comes to your condition. I would advise seeing a family doctor on the ground who can hear your story, evaluate the workups performed by the specialists, and coming up with a plan for empiric treatment or referral to another specialist that may offer some insight into the situation.

A 27-year-old female asked:
Im having itchy outer ears. Dry flakes skin is build up in my outer ear and on my tragus. What could this be? what can l do to help it? do i see an ear doctor or dermatologist?
Dr. Birendra Tandan
Urology 36 years experience
First try OTC hydrocortisone cream over the areas for a week or so if it does not get better see a dermatologist.
